diff options
author | corey drew bruce | 2024-04-20 14:50:17 +1000 |
---|---|---|
committer | corey drew bruce | 2024-04-20 14:50:17 +1000 |
commit | 0c86dd6d6cb9a756710bc276e3f5d97b9f07b05c (patch) | |
tree | c5f799ecccdbbe9fb61e63368e3bc7b16034cd18 | |
parent | 1876295c19912fe517b9db819b5637580bdfec31 (diff) | |
download | aur-0c86dd6d6cb9a756710bc276e3f5d97b9f07b05c.tar.gz |
- Updated repo link as I have moved it to a big main repository for all my projects - Added the checksums to the package
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| .sync-conflict-20240415-235438-XPZ3XY2.SRCINFO | 19 | ||||
-rw-r--r-- | .sync-conflict-20240416-000149-XPZ3XY2.SRCINFO | 19 | ||||
-rw-r--r-- | .syncthing..sync-conflict-20240415-235438-XPZ3XY2.SRCINFO.tmp | 19 | ||||
-rw-r--r-- | .syncthing..sync-conflict-20240416-000149-XPZ3XY2.SRCINFO.tmp | 19 | ||||
-rwxr-xr-x | .syncthing.PKGBUILD.sync-conflict-20240415-235438-XPZ3XY2.tmp | 33 | ||||
-rwxr-xr-x | .syncthing.PKGBUILD.sync-conflict-20240416-000203-XPZ3XY2.tmp | 33 | ||||
-rwxr-xr-x | PKGBUILD | 8 |
8 files changed, 148 insertions, 8 deletions
@@ -2,7 +2,7 @@ pkgbase = syncthingdesktop pkgdesc = Unnofficial Syncthing desktop application pkgver = 1.0.1 pkgrel = 1 - url = https://gitlab.com/syncthingdesktop + url = https://gitlab.com/linuxbombay/syncthingdesktop arch = x86_64 arch = aarch64 license = GPL @@ -13,7 +13,7 @@ pkgbase = syncthingdesktop depends = libxss depends = git depends = syncthing - source = https://github.com/syncthingdesktop-pkg/application/archive/refs/tags/1.0.1-1.tar.gz - sha256sums = SKIP + source = https://gitlab.com/linuxbombay/syncthingdesktop/application/-/archive/1.0.1-1/application-1.0.1-1.tar.bz2 + sha256sums = 8e989008e07ae56c8ce6bb313e1e137eb201c4a38a61cc7dc3427af509f620f2 pkgname = syncthingdesktop diff --git a/.sync-conflict-20240415-235438-XPZ3XY2.SRCINFO b/.sync-conflict-20240415-235438-XPZ3XY2.SRCINFO new file mode 100644 index 000000000000..e62213f01bc9 --- /dev/null +++ b/.sync-conflict-20240415-235438-XPZ3XY2.SRCINFO @@ -0,0 +1,19 @@ +pkgbase = syncthingdesktop + pkgdesc = Unnofficial Syncthing desktop application + pkgver = 1.0.1 + pkgrel = 1 + url = https://gitlab.com/syncthingdesktop + arch = x86_64 + arch = aarch64 + license = GPL + makedepends = unzip + depends = libelectron + depends = nss + depends = gtk3 + depends = libxss + depends = git + depends = syncthing + source = https://gitlab.com/syncthingdesktop/application/-/archive/1.0.1-1/application-1.0.1-1.tar.bz2 + sha256sums = SKIP + +pkgname = syncthingdesktop diff --git a/.sync-conflict-20240416-000149-XPZ3XY2.SRCINFO b/.sync-conflict-20240416-000149-XPZ3XY2.SRCINFO new file mode 100644 index 000000000000..e62213f01bc9 --- /dev/null +++ b/.sync-conflict-20240416-000149-XPZ3XY2.SRCINFO @@ -0,0 +1,19 @@ +pkgbase = syncthingdesktop + pkgdesc = Unnofficial Syncthing desktop application + pkgver = 1.0.1 + pkgrel = 1 + url = https://gitlab.com/syncthingdesktop + arch = x86_64 + arch = aarch64 + license = GPL + makedepends = unzip + depends = libelectron + depends = nss + depends = gtk3 + depends = libxss + depends = git + depends = syncthing + source = https://gitlab.com/syncthingdesktop/application/-/archive/1.0.1-1/application-1.0.1-1.tar.bz2 + sha256sums = SKIP + +pkgname = syncthingdesktop diff --git a/.syncthing..sync-conflict-20240415-235438-XPZ3XY2.SRCINFO.tmp b/.syncthing..sync-conflict-20240415-235438-XPZ3XY2.SRCINFO.tmp new file mode 100644 index 000000000000..e62213f01bc9 --- /dev/null +++ b/.syncthing..sync-conflict-20240415-235438-XPZ3XY2.SRCINFO.tmp @@ -0,0 +1,19 @@ +pkgbase = syncthingdesktop + pkgdesc = Unnofficial Syncthing desktop application + pkgver = 1.0.1 + pkgrel = 1 + url = https://gitlab.com/syncthingdesktop + arch = x86_64 + arch = aarch64 + license = GPL + makedepends = unzip + depends = libelectron + depends = nss + depends = gtk3 + depends = libxss + depends = git + depends = syncthing + source = https://gitlab.com/syncthingdesktop/application/-/archive/1.0.1-1/application-1.0.1-1.tar.bz2 + sha256sums = SKIP + +pkgname = syncthingdesktop diff --git a/.syncthing..sync-conflict-20240416-000149-XPZ3XY2.SRCINFO.tmp b/.syncthing..sync-conflict-20240416-000149-XPZ3XY2.SRCINFO.tmp new file mode 100644 index 000000000000..e62213f01bc9 --- /dev/null +++ b/.syncthing..sync-conflict-20240416-000149-XPZ3XY2.SRCINFO.tmp @@ -0,0 +1,19 @@ +pkgbase = syncthingdesktop + pkgdesc = Unnofficial Syncthing desktop application + pkgver = 1.0.1 + pkgrel = 1 + url = https://gitlab.com/syncthingdesktop + arch = x86_64 + arch = aarch64 + license = GPL + makedepends = unzip + depends = libelectron + depends = nss + depends = gtk3 + depends = libxss + depends = git + depends = syncthing + source = https://gitlab.com/syncthingdesktop/application/-/archive/1.0.1-1/application-1.0.1-1.tar.bz2 + sha256sums = SKIP + +pkgname = syncthingdesktop diff --git a/.syncthing.PKGBUILD.sync-conflict-20240415-235438-XPZ3XY2.tmp b/.syncthing.PKGBUILD.sync-conflict-20240415-235438-XPZ3XY2.tmp new file mode 100755 index 000000000000..7887c44f3feb --- /dev/null +++ b/.syncthing.PKGBUILD.sync-conflict-20240415-235438-XPZ3XY2.tmp @@ -0,0 +1,33 @@ +pkgname=syncthingdesktop +_pkgname=SyncthingDesktop +pkgver=1.0.1 +pkgrel=1 +pkgdesc="Unnofficial Syncthing desktop application" +arch=('x86_64' 'aarch64') +url="https://gitlab.com/syncthingdesktop" +license=('GPL') +depends=('libelectron' 'nss' 'gtk3' 'libxss' 'git' 'syncthing') +makedepends=('unzip') +source=("https://gitlab.com/syncthingdesktop/application/-/archive/$pkgver-$pkgrel/application-$pkgver-$pkgrel.tar.bz2") +sha256sums=('SKIP') + + +package() { + cd "$srcdir/application-$pkgver-$pkgrel" + chmod +x $pkgname + ln -sf "/opt/libelectron/node_modules" "$srcdir/application-$pkgver-$pkgrel" + install -dm755 "$pkgdir/opt/$_pkgname" + install -dm755 "$pkgdir/usr/share/pixmaps" + cp -r ./ "$pkgdir/opt/$_pkgname" + cp -r "$pkgdir/opt/$_pkgname/$pkgname.svg" "$pkgdir/usr/share/pixmaps" + + + # Link to binary + install -dm755 "$pkgdir/usr/bin" + ln -s "/opt/$_pkgname/$pkgname" "$pkgdir/usr/bin/$pkgname" + + # Desktop Entry + install -Dm644 "$srcdir/application-$pkgver-$pkgrel/$pkgname.desktop" \ + "$pkgdir/usr/share/applications/$pkgname.desktop" + sed -i s%/usr/share%/opt% "$pkgdir/usr/share/applications/$pkgname.desktop" +} diff --git a/.syncthing.PKGBUILD.sync-conflict-20240416-000203-XPZ3XY2.tmp b/.syncthing.PKGBUILD.sync-conflict-20240416-000203-XPZ3XY2.tmp new file mode 100755 index 000000000000..7887c44f3feb --- /dev/null +++ b/.syncthing.PKGBUILD.sync-conflict-20240416-000203-XPZ3XY2.tmp @@ -0,0 +1,33 @@ +pkgname=syncthingdesktop +_pkgname=SyncthingDesktop +pkgver=1.0.1 +pkgrel=1 +pkgdesc="Unnofficial Syncthing desktop application" +arch=('x86_64' 'aarch64') +url="https://gitlab.com/syncthingdesktop" +license=('GPL') +depends=('libelectron' 'nss' 'gtk3' 'libxss' 'git' 'syncthing') +makedepends=('unzip') +source=("https://gitlab.com/syncthingdesktop/application/-/archive/$pkgver-$pkgrel/application-$pkgver-$pkgrel.tar.bz2") +sha256sums=('SKIP') + + +package() { + cd "$srcdir/application-$pkgver-$pkgrel" + chmod +x $pkgname + ln -sf "/opt/libelectron/node_modules" "$srcdir/application-$pkgver-$pkgrel" + install -dm755 "$pkgdir/opt/$_pkgname" + install -dm755 "$pkgdir/usr/share/pixmaps" + cp -r ./ "$pkgdir/opt/$_pkgname" + cp -r "$pkgdir/opt/$_pkgname/$pkgname.svg" "$pkgdir/usr/share/pixmaps" + + + # Link to binary + install -dm755 "$pkgdir/usr/bin" + ln -s "/opt/$_pkgname/$pkgname" "$pkgdir/usr/bin/$pkgname" + + # Desktop Entry + install -Dm644 "$srcdir/application-$pkgver-$pkgrel/$pkgname.desktop" \ + "$pkgdir/usr/share/applications/$pkgname.desktop" + sed -i s%/usr/share%/opt% "$pkgdir/usr/share/applications/$pkgname.desktop" +} @@ -4,14 +4,12 @@ pkgver=1.0.1 pkgrel=1 pkgdesc="Unnofficial Syncthing desktop application" arch=('x86_64' 'aarch64') -url="https://gitlab.com/syncthingdesktop" +url="https://gitlab.com/linuxbombay/syncthingdesktop" license=('GPL') depends=('libelectron' 'nss' 'gtk3' 'libxss' 'git' 'syncthing') makedepends=('unzip') -#source=("https://gitlab.com/syncthingdesktop/application/-/archive/$pkgver-$pkgrel/application-$pkgver-$pkgrel.tar.bz2") -#Backup temp repo -source=("https://github.com/syncthingdesktop-pkg/application/archive/refs/tags/$pkgver-$pkgrel.tar.gz") -sha256sums=('SKIP') +source=("https://gitlab.com/linuxbombay/syncthingdesktop/application/-/archive/$pkgver-$pkgrel/application-$pkgver-$pkgrel.tar.bz2") +sha256sums=('8e989008e07ae56c8ce6bb313e1e137eb201c4a38a61cc7dc3427af509f620f2') package() { |